One of the key areas where AI-powered assistive technology is making a difference is in communication. For individuals with speech or hearing impairments, AI-powered speech recognition and natural language processing technologies can facilitate communication by converting spoken language into written text or vice versa. This enables individuals to engage in conversations, participate in meetings, and access information more easily.

Another area where AI-powered assistive technology is making significant strides is in mobility and navigation. For individuals with visual impairments, AI algorithms can be used to analyze and interpret visual information from cameras or sensors, providing real-time feedback and guidance. This can help individuals navigate their surroundings independently, enhancing their mobility and reducing their reliance on others.

Furthermore, AI-powered assistive technology is also being used to improve accessibility in education. By leveraging AI algorithms, educational platforms can adapt and personalize content to meet the specific learning needs of individuals with disabilities. This ensures that everyone has equal access to education and can learn at their own pace and in their preferred style.

In addition to enhancing accessibility, AI-powered assistive technology also promotes inclusion by fostering social interaction and engagement. For individuals with autism spectrum disorder, AI-powered social robots can provide companionship and support, helping them develop social skills and improve their overall well-being. These robots can engage in conversations, provide emotional support, and even assist with daily tasks, empowering individuals to live more independently.
